Big power play on the way in Division 5 South
DIV. 5-6 PREVIEW
Division 5 South is clearly the section of resumes.
Falmouth and Hanover captured Super Bowl titles last year, while Holliston has been a perennial contender under coach Todd Kiley. That being said, two teams to watch in this section are Dennis-Yarmouth and Scituate. Both teams return a slew of talent and have to be considered preseason favorites to get through a difficult group.
Div. 5 North looks to be a bit top-heavy as Lynnfield, Watertown and Triton may be a step above the field. Lynnfield returns a solid nucleus and just might be the favorite by the end of the season.
In Div. 6 North, the season-opener between Bishop Fenwick and Hamilton-Wenham pits a pair of teams that should be in the hunt for the sectional title. Another team to watch is Stoneham, a solid team that has fared well in the Middlesex Freedom in recent years.
East Bridgewater returns several players who started on last year’s Div. 3A Super Bowl championship team and thus should be a contender in Div. 6 South. In the South Shore League, Middleboro will be a definite threat to East Bridgewater. The teams played a classic last season. Cardinal Spellman is a dangerous sleeper and one of the preseason favorites in the Catholic Central Large. Old Rochester has workhorse running back Harry Smith returning for another season.
